Your tarantula looks like a G. iheringi to me. I've owned several adults. Grammastola actaeon lose the red colored setae and eventually it will turn black....much like a fuzzy G. pulchra..... G. iheringi will keep the red colored setae on the abdomen permanently. Also, actaeon get MUCH bigger than iheringi. If I'm not mistaken, it's the largest of the Grammastola species.....but I could be wrong.
